原文:Tomcat源碼分析——Session管理分析(下)

前言 在 TOMCAT源碼分析 SESSION管理分析 上 一文中我介紹了Session Session管理器,還以StandardManager為例介紹了Session管理器的初始化與啟動,本文將接着介紹Session管理的其它內容。 Session分配 在 TOMCAT源碼分析 請求原理分析 下 一文的最后我們介紹了Filter的職責鏈,Tomcat接收到的請求會經過Filter職責鏈,最后交 ...

2015-11-04 09:43 1 2858 推薦指數:

查看詳情

Tomcat源碼分析——Session管理分析(上)

前言   對於廣大java開發者而已,對於J2EE規范中的Session應該並不陌生,我們可以使用Session管理用戶的會話信息,最常見的就是拿Session用來存放用戶登錄、身份、權限及狀態等信息。對於使用Tomcat作為Web容器的大部分開發人員而言,Tomcat是如何實現Session ...

Mon Nov 02 17:01:00 CST 2015 0 5719
Tomcat源碼分析——請求原理分析

前言   本文繼續講解TOMCAT的請求原理分析,建議朋友們閱讀本文時首先閱讀過《TOMCAT源碼分析——請求原理分析(上)》和《TOMCAT源碼分析——請求原理分析(中)》。在《TOMCAT源碼分析——請求原理分析(中)》一文我簡單講到了Pipeline,但並未完全展開,本文將從 ...

Sat Oct 24 01:23:00 CST 2015 0 4467
Tomcat源碼分析——生命周期管理

前言   從server.xml文件解析出來的各個對象都是容器,比如:Server、Service、Connector等。這些容器都具有新建、初始化完成、啟動、停止、失敗、銷毀等狀態。tomcat的實現提供了對這些容器的生命周期管理,本文將通過對Tomcat7.0的源碼閱讀,深入剖析這一 ...

Mon Oct 12 20:20:00 CST 2015 0 4652
Tomcat源碼分析 (十)----- 徹底理解 Session機制

Tomcat Session 概述 首先 HTTP 是一個無狀態的協議, 這意味着每次發起的HTTP請求, 都是一個全新的請求(與上個請求沒有任何聯系, 服務端不會保留上個請求的任何信息), 而 Session 的出現就是為了解決這個問題, 將 Client 端的每次請求都關聯起來, 要實現 ...

Fri Aug 23 18:50:00 CST 2019 3 1103
TOMCAT8源碼分析——處理請求分析

前言   本文繼續講解TOMCAT的請求原理分析,建議朋友們閱讀本文時首先閱讀過《TOMCAT源碼分析——請求原理分析(上)》和《TOMCAT源碼分析——請求原理分析(中)》。在《TOMCAT源碼分析——請求原理分析(中)》一文我簡單講到了Pipeline,但並未完全展開,本文將從 ...

Sat Mar 31 02:03:00 CST 2018 0 1686
Tomcat 源碼分析(轉)

本文轉自:http://blog.csdn.net/haitao111313/article/category/1179996 Tomcat源碼分析(一)--服務啟動 1. Tomcat主要有兩個組件,連接器和容器,所謂連接器就是一個http請求過來了,連接器負責接收這個請求,然后轉發給容器 ...

Sun Dec 13 03:44:00 CST 2015 1 2420
Tomcat源碼分析(一)

這段時間簡單的看了一Tomcat源碼,在這里做個筆記! 1. tomcat 架構圖 Catalina: tomcat的頂級容器,main()方法中就是通過,創建Catalina 對象實例,來啟動或者關閉 tomcat; Server: 是管理tomcat所有組件的容器,包含 ...

Mon Nov 30 16:45:00 CST 2015 0 2746
Tomcat源碼分析--轉

一、架構 下面談談我對Tomcat架構的理解 總體架構: 1、面向組件架構 2、基於JMX 3、事件偵聽 1)面向組件架構 tomcat代碼看似很龐大,但從結構上看卻很清晰和簡單,它主要由一堆組件組成,如Server、Service、Connector等,並基於JMX管理這些組件 ...

Thu Jul 03 06:56:00 CST 2014 0 3941
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M